The issue here is that Apple Computer makes agreements with Apple Records, then blatantly breaks the agreements a few years down the line:

Be careful what you say. You do NOT know what the agreement says. You do not have access to it. For all you know the agreement specifically disallows Apple using the Apple name on any music products. Which guess what, iTunes Music Store does not do.


Obviously Apple has lawyers. Don't pretend to know more about the legalese of the contract then the lawyers who actually have access to it.

* That case was settled, with the new provision that Apple Computer never get into the business of selling or marketing music. A few years later, Apple began selling and marketing music.


You do not know what the provision was or what the wording is. At best you are relying either on the statements of informed journalist who are GUESSING, or someone within Apple Corps who is violating the confidentiality agreement and leaking their slant on the agreement.

It's pretty obvious Apple was aware they were breaking the first agreement, as they basically baited Apple Records with the "so sue me" thing. They must have been well aware this suit was coming, too. It doesn't help that Jobs, a huge fan of the Beatles, has admitted he named his computer company after their record label.

Really? Where? I've heard that as an anecdote, but never have I seen an actual quote. The story I've heard was that the Steve's couldn't come up with a name and Steve was eating an Apple and said, "If we can't think of anything, let's call it 'Apple.'"
